IaaS、PaaS、SaaS是云计算的三种服务模式1. SaaS:Software-as-a-Service(软件即服务)提供给客户的服务是运营商运行在云计算基础设施上的应用程序,用户可以在各种设备上通过客户端界面访问,如浏览器。消费者不需要管理或控制任何云计算基础设施,包括网络、服务器、操作系统、存储等等;2. PaaS:Platform-as-a-Service(平台即服务)提供给消费者的服务
SaaS即Software-as-a-service(软件即服务)的缩写,指提供商为企业搭建信息化所需要的所有网络基础设施网络基础设施及软件、硬件运作平台,并负责所有前期的实施、后期的维护等一系列服务。SaaS平台是目前互联网技术的发展和应用软件的成熟而兴起的一种全新的软件应用模式。客户可根据自己的实际需要,通过互联网向制造商订购所需的应用软件服务,支付费用获得制造商提供的服务,用户不需要购买软件
转载
2023-07-27 17:02:35
128阅读
SaaS微服务架构
# 1. 引言
随着云计算和软件即服务(Software as a Service, SaaS)的兴起,微服务架构也变得越来越受欢迎。SaaS微服务架构将软件拆分成多个小型、自治的服务,每个服务都可以独立开发、部署和扩展。本文将介绍SaaS微服务架构的基本概念、设计原则和实现方式,并通过代码示例来展示其工作原理。
# 2. SaaS微服务架构的基本概念
SaaS微服务架
原创
2023-09-16 17:03:25
213阅读
昨天为了跟00后划清界限,十八岁的照片刷屏了;今天跨年,朋友圈又刷屏了。而这背后支撑海量数据、高并发的接口调用的,就是这几年火起来的微服务。其实微服务并非新概念,而是从原来的SOA之类的概念演化而来。今天这里仅对微服务架构做初步探讨。 记得08年刚踏入程序猿这条不归路的时候,呆在一家小公司“无偿”无压力地看书自学、写写小项目,那会儿公司就在搞一个SAAS项目,得知了啥是“软件即服务”这个说法
转载
2023-10-05 10:01:18
98阅读
1、现在公司的基本情况现在所有的企业都开始拥抱微服务的框架模式saas化:Software As A Service 软件即服务pass化:Platform As A Service 平台即服务微服务的好处可以降低成本费用1.1构架的分类单体架构SOA面向服务的架构分布式架构微服务架构在微服务的架构模式下,使用的也是轻量级的通信模式(REST API),在微服务的架构模式中,需要清楚的是它的通信可
摘要:SaaS(Software as a Service)应用作为一种新型的软件服务模式,在日常生产生活中越来越重要.在SaaS应用的落地过程中传统的的单体架构不能满足SaaS应用的需求,于是微服务架构应运而生,补齐了单体架构的短板,大大的促进了SaaS应用的发展,但是由于它产生时间不久,微服务架构还存在一些问题.首先构建一个微服务系统之时,单个服务的粒度往往难以把握,一个划分不成熟的微服务系统
文章目录一、什么是SaaS?二、数字商城系统介绍三、技术栈以及项目特点四、系统设计五、系统部分功能演示?店铺管理功能演示图?商品管理功能演示图?订单功能演示图?营销管理功能演示图六、系统部分源代码作者:KJ.JK 一、什么是SaaS?SaaS的英文全称是Software as a Service,意思是软件即服务,是云计算的其中一种服务模式 SaaS是一种通过Internet提供集中托管应用程序
# saas微服务架构介绍
在当今互联网时代,随着用户需求的多样化和业务的复杂性不断增加,传统的单体架构已经无法满足快速发展的需求。因此,微服务架构逐渐成为了一种流行的架构模式。而在微服务架构中,SAAS(Software as a Service)是一种常见的服务模式,它将应用程序作为一种服务提供给用户。
## 什么是SAAS微服务架构
SAAS微服务架构是将应用程序拆分成多个独立的微服务
在大型系统或者大数据系统处理中,微服务模式是有一定的优势的,因为微服务的模式本质上就是对要处理的数据进行纵向划分,也就是按功能模块(按服务)划分,需要注意的是,每个微服务背后的数据库应该是独立存储的,也可以异构,这个可以根据自己的需要来进行选择。但做SaaS系统,一般都是多用租赁模式,对于分割的基本需求就是按”用户“来分割,这种分割是横向的,这和微服务的思想是违背的。多用户租赁,以用户为视角是第一
SAAS@(saas)[saas服务, 帮助]腾讯云SAAS服务该方式下,用户购买后会接收应用访问 URL 地址,通过服务商提供的账号密码访问或免登 URL 访问应用,直接使用服务。同时,支持版本升级、续费等特性。microsoft介绍软件即服务(SAAS):让用户能够通过Internet连接并使用基于云的应用程序, 示例:电子邮件、日历、办公工具(Microsoft Office 365)SAA
什么是微服务架构?微服务架构就是把一个大系统按业务功能分解成多个职责单一的小系统,并利用简单的方法使多个小系统相互协作,组合成一个大系统。就是把因相同原因而变化的功能聚合到一起,而把因不同原因而变化的功能分离开,并利用轻量化机制(通常为HTTP RESTful API)实现通信。微服务架构是一种架构模式,它提倡将单一应用程序划分成一组小的服务,服务之间互相协调、互相配合,为用户提供最终价值。每个服
这两年SaaS模式的概念很火爆,今天理一下SaaS的概念。一、概念 SaaS是Software-as-a-service(软件即服务)。SaaS提供商为企业搭建信息化所需要的所有网络基础设施及软件、硬件运作平台,并负责所有前期的实施、后期的维护等一系列服务,企业无需购买软硬件、建设机房、招聘IT人员,即可通过互联网使用信息系统。就像打开自来水龙头就能用水一样,企业根据实际
公有云SAAS产品不同于传统的软件包产品,我们不仅需要负责软件的研发,同时需要负责产品的运维,面对众多用户,需要保障产品7X24不间断运行;客户业务是不断变化的,产品需要在持续运行过程中进行持续升级,以满足客户业务不断变化的需要。相对传统软件包产品,公有云产品的升级更加复杂,风险也更高,类似于在运动的汽车上更换轮胎。设计的本质就是让产品变化更容易。微服务架构是互联网时代以适应快速的业务变化而产生的
随着互联网技术的飞速发展,传统软件模式在互联网技术的融合下成就了互联网在线软件服务模式的形成。使得互联网在线软件服务商提出了软件即服务的概念,从而诞生了SaaS软件服务模式。SaaS是Software-as-a-service(软件即服务)。它与“on-demand software”(按需软件),the application service provider(ASP,应用服务提供商),host
什么是微服务?微服务架构的优缺点、应用?微服务(micro services)这个概念不是新概念,很多公司已经在实践了,例如亚马逊、Google、FaceBook、Alibaba。微服务架构模式(Microservices Architecture Pattern)的目的是将大型的、复杂的、长期运行的应用程序构建为一组相互配合的服务,每个服务都可以很容易得局部改良。 Micro这个词意味着每个服务
当前,选择PaaS或者IaaS构建微服务是个非常火热的话题。本文主要会就基于PaaS和IaaS实现微服务架构的6大不同之处进行详细阐述。为什么要使用微服务架构?烟囱式的系统构架,可能会变成构建企业级大型处理系统的建设瓶颈,造成应用程序迭代更新的难点所在。基于传统的烟囱式系统建设方式,要实现应用的逻辑功能升级或者移植,往往需要重新编译和部署整个应用,工作量很大,并且有很多潜在的安全性风险,运维成本高
云服务现在已经快成了一个家喻户晓的词了。如果你不知道PaaS, IaaS 和SaaS的区别,那么也没啥,因为很多人确实不知道。云其实是互联网的一个隐喻,云计算其实就是使用互联网来接入存储或者运行在远程服务器端的应用,数据,或者服务。任何一个使用基于互联网的方法来计算,存储和开发的公司,都可以从技术上叫做从事云的公司。然而,不
1、什么是SaaS? SaaS是Software-as-a-Service(软件即服务)的简称,随着互联网技术的发展和应用软件的成熟, 在21世纪开始兴起的一种完全创新的软件应用模式。用户不用再购买软件,而改用向提供商租用基于Web的软件,来管理企业经营活动,且无需对软件进行维护,服务提供商会全权管理和维护软件,对于许多小型企业来说,SaaS是采用先进技术的最好途径,它消除了企业购买、构建和维护基
# Java 微服务SaaS平台架构
随着云计算和微服务架构的兴起,SaaS(Software as a Service)平台越来越受到企业的欢迎。本文将介绍如何使用Java构建一个微服务SaaS平台架构,并提供代码示例和关系图。
## 微服务架构概述
微服务架构是一种将应用程序分解为一组小型、独立服务的架构风格。每个服务运行在自己的进程中,并通过轻量级的通信机制(通常是HTTP RESTf
aaS都是as-a-service(即服务)的意思。IaaS: Infrastructure-as-a-Service(基础设施即服务)第一层叫做IaaS,有时候也叫做Hardware-as-a-Service。PaaS: Platform-as-a-Service(平台即服务)第二层就是所谓的PaaS,某些时候也叫做中间件。你公司所有的开发都可以在这一层进行,节省了时间和资源。PaaS公司在网上